WebA seller financing transaction typically involves a Deed from the Seller to to the Buyer and then the Buyer signs a Promissory Note and Mortgage back to the seller (instead of a bank). In some states a Deed of Trust, Trust Deed, or Security Deed are used instead of a Mortgage. In other states a Land Contract or Contract For Deed are used. WebJul 14, 2014 · What is a Promissory Note? A promissory note is a form of debt that companies sometimes use, like loans, to raise money. The company, through the notes, promises to return the buyer's funds (principal), and to make fixed interest payments to the buyer in exchange for borrowing the money.
